Tomas — before I leave for Harwick, here's what you need for the shuttle-bus gate at the Oakdene Park campus. The gate opens automatically for badged drivers between 06:30 and 19:00; outside those hours, assistants must release it manually from the kiosk. Always confirm the driver's run sheet first, then log the release time. The kiosk keypad accepts the code below.

door code, yagap-bahof: bdg-O-05

# Vendoring Third-Party Fonts

Before adding any font to the Lanternware repo, confirm the license permits redistribution and record it in the manifest. The Typeworks guild reviews each request at the weekly eng sync; bring the license file and intended usage. Checksums must be pinned in the vendor lockfile. Questions about unclear license terms should be sent ahead of the sync.

escalation mailbox, fafof-bahip: tamael@ordincorp.test

## Step 4: Reconfigure the ChipGate reader service

After upgrading the Veldtrack firmware on each ChipGate timing-chip reader, the legacy polling daemon must be replaced with the new streaming collector. Stop the old service, remove its init script, and install the collector package from the Veldtrack internal mirror. The collector will refuse to start until its mat-array mappings and antenna gain settings are defined. Apply the following configuration values before restarting:

service settings:
[silwyn]
host = silwyn.crelvogrid.internal
user = silwyn_svc
database = silwyn_prod

Hi — quick note ahead of Thursday's DR drill at Pinewharf. We'll be failing over the audit-log viewer to the Marrowfield replica, so expect read-only gaps of a few minutes. Nothing scary, but please watch for missing entries afterward. To restore the viewer's admin session post-failover, enter the recovery passphrase below.

strongbox words: sorir-belvan-rusix-ulays-ralmir-praix-eliir-tamax-praael-druael-julir-tamius-jorir